Description

Mount Eagles Wings #3 is an assisted living community located in Martinez, GA. The community offers a range of amenities and care services to ensure that residents are comfortable and well taken care of.

The community features a spacious dining room where residents can enjoy delicious meals prepared by the staff. All accommodations are fully furnished, providing a cozy and inviting atmosphere for residents to feel at home. Additionally, there is a beautiful garden on the premises where residents can relax and enjoy the outdoors.

Housekeeping services are provided to maintain a clean and tidy living environment for all residents. Move-in coordination assistance is also available to make the transition into the community as smooth as possible. Residents will have access to outdoor spaces where they can enjoy fresh air and socialize with other residents.

To stay connected, Mount Eagles Wings #3 offers telephone services as well as Wi-Fi/high-speed internet access for all residents. This allows them to communicate with their loved ones or browse the internet at their leisure.

Care services provided by the community include assistance with activities of daily living, such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. The staff also coordinates with healthcare providers to ensure that residents receive proper medical attention when needed. Special attention is given to those who require a diabetes diet or have special dietary restrictions.

Medication management is another important aspect of care provided at Mount Eagles Wings #3. Trained staff members assist in ensuring that medications are taken correctly and on time. Transportation arrangements for medical visits are available so that residents can easily attend appointments without any hassle.
